🪶There is an image in the Taittirīya Upaniṣad that I keep returning to. The teaching is shared through the shape of a bird, wings outstretched, head forward, tail behind.
Same form. Different contents.
Not a ladder to climb. Not layers to peel away. A bird. Five times over. Each one nested inside the last. Each one complete in itself.
This is the Pañcamāyā and it quietly overturns the way most of us were taught to think about ourselves. We were taught separation. Body over here, mind over there. Spirit somewhere above it all, waiting to be reached if we just practice hard enough, sit still enough, let go enough.
But the Upaniṣad offers us something different.
Not the goal of leaving the body behind but of recognising that Annamāya, the food body, is temporary and yet already a perfect expression of the whole. That Prāṇamāya, the energy body, animates this same form, carrying something subtler. That Manomāya, the thinking mind, is not the obstacle — it is the wing that catches the wind, allowing us to reflect, think and act. That Vijñānamāya, the wisdom body, is not reserved for the advanced practitioner — it is already present, waiting to be revealed. And that Ānandamāya bliss is not the destination. It is who we are at our core.
It was never absent.
What if the goal of yoga is not to rise above yourself but to recognise your own wholeness?
What if every āsana, every breath, every moment of sitting quietly is not about getting somewhere but about remembering that the bird already knows how to fly?
